Love may feel proud like a peacock, on display for the world to see . . . But it may also sing a softer song that goes unheard to those who are not listening.There are many ways that we can feel and give love. Told through a collection of beautiful animal similes, Love Is... looks at love in all its beauty. Sublime illustrations explore themes such as self-love, a parent's love for a new baby, the bond between siblings, friendship, fighting for what you believe in and missing someone who's no longer there.Following on from Sarah Maycock's award-winning Sometimes I Feel..., this picture book perfectly captures the many facets of love in just a few swoops of ink.

Lily Murray (Author)
Lily grew up in the wilds of snowy nowhere, spending much of her time talking to animals and making up stories. She has continued to do this in her adult life, and now writes fiction and non-fiction books for children. Her titles include Dinosaurium, Beneath the Waves and Five Little Chicks.

Sarah Maycock (Illustrator)
Sarah Maycock studied Illustration at Kingston University and in 2011 was selected as an It's Nice That Graduate. Notably, in 2018, she was commissioned to create a series of illustrations for London Natural History Museum's 2018 Whales exhibition. She trained herself to draw animals from nature documentaries. Her unique ability to capture a creature's characteristics or the forces of nature in just a few swoops of ink is incomparable and truly impressive. Sarah's book Sometimes I Feel... won the ALCS Educational Writers' Award in 2021. Sarah lives in Hastings, UK.
